Your Clothes

I believe that clothes should be more than functional. They should make a statement about who you
are. Before you get dressed or go shopping for clothing, it’s important to think about what kind of message
your clothes will send to others.

I think of clothes as a reflection of my personality. When people look at me and my clothes, they can
get an idea of the kind of person I am. I’m interested in the arts, and I’m concerned about environmental

issues. Therefore, I not only wear colourful clothes that are a bit unusual, but I also wear natural fabrics that
are made locally. This is important to me.

I don’t follow trends because I don’t want to look like everyone else. I’m unique and I want my
clothes to show it.
